Overview
The ADS1224IPWR from Texas Instruments is a 4-channel, 24-bit, delta-sigma analog-to-digital (A/D) converter. It is designed to offer excellent performance and low power consumption, making it suitable for demanding, high-resolution measurements in portable systems and other space-saving, power-constrained applications. The device features a delta-sigma modulator followed by a digital filter and includes an input multiplexer that allows selection between four separate differential input channels. A pin-selectable, high-impedance input buffer is also available to increase the input impedance. The ADS1224IPWR supports a simple 2-wire serial interface for control and data retrieval, and it includes an on-chip temperature sensor. It operates with analog and digital supplies ranging from 2.7V to 5.5V and has a low current consumption of 300µA, with power consumption typically less than 1mW in 3V operation and less than 1µW during Standby mode.
Key Specifications
Parameter | Value | Units |
---|---|---|
Number of Channels | 4 | - |
Resolution | 24 bits | - |
Data Rate | 120 SPS (with fCLK = 2MHz) | SPS |
Integral Nonlinearity (INL) | 0.0003% (typ), 0.0015% (max) | % of FSR |
Differential Input Range | ±5V | V |
Analog Supply Voltage | 2.7V to 5.5V | V |
Digital Supply Voltage | 2.7V to 5.5V | V |
Current Consumption | 300µA | µA |
Operating Temperature Range | −40°C to +85°C | °C |
Package Type | TSSOP-20 | - |
